Shaping Futures: The Prison Outreach Program of the New Hampshire Furniture Masters

Don’t miss our newest exhibit at the Fuller Craft Museum in Brockton, MA, featuring pieces created by the Prison Outreach Program’s participants. All sales proceeds from the show will benefit the Prison Outreach Program. Join us this Saturday, January 24th from 2-4pm for an opening reception and panel, Building Bridges: Creative Practice and Partnership in Prison Systems, featuring Furniture Masters Eric Grant, Howard Hatch, Lynn Szymanski, and Leah Woods, as well as Lee Perlman, Co-Director of the The Educational Justice Institute at MIT. The exhibition runs from January 24th through June 7th, 2026.

Commissioning & Collecting: The Legacy of Arthur Clarke

Arthur Clarke and Susan Sloan have been friends of the New Hampshire Furniture Masters since its inception thirty years ago. Featuring both personally commissioned pieces and those they’ve collected over the years, Arthur has returned these pieces to the organization with the goal of sharing his and Susan’s love of the work. Joined Together: 30 Years of the Furniture Masters

The NH Furniture Masters are thrilled to have our work on display as part of a major exhibition at the Currier Museum of Art in Manchester, NH. Joined Together: 30 Years of the Furniture Masters is on display now through February 8, 2026. Please stop by to view this exceptional exhibition.

30th Anniversary Book – Buy Now!

As a celebration of our 30th anniversary, the NH Furniture Masters have published a hardcover book, which serves as a catalog of work for our exhibition at the Currier Museum of Art as well as a record of the history and impact of the NH Furniture Masters over the past 30 years.
